What does the T-2A 'Double curve, first to the right' sign mean?

The T-2A sign is a warning that the road ahead features a double bend. The first curve will be to the right, followed by another curve, usually to the left. It signals a need to reduce speed and increase your awareness.

How should I react when I see the T-2A warning sign?

Upon seeing the T-2A sign, you should immediately start preparing for the upcoming curves. This means checking your mirrors, gently reducing your speed before the bend, and ensuring you have a good following distance. Maintain a safe position on the road throughout both curves.

Are there any actions prohibited when I see the T-2A sign?

Yes, you must not ignore this warning sign, even if the bend isn't immediately visible. Avoid accelerating hard, overtaking, or making sudden lane changes where it could compromise safety. Also, don't fixate only on the sign; continue to scan the road and traffic.

What are common mistakes learners make with the T-2A sign during the theory exam?

A common trap is not slowing down early enough. Learners might wait until they are close to the curve. Remember, the T-2A sign is an early warning, prompting you to adjust speed and observation *before* the hazard. Another mistake is focusing only on the first curve and not anticipating the second.

Does the T-2A sign mean I must always stop or yield?

No, the T-2A sign itself doesn't mandate stopping or yielding. It's a warning about the road's geometry. However, the conditions associated with the curve (like reduced visibility, oncoming traffic, or junctions) might require you to slow down significantly, yield, or even stop, depending on the specific situation.
